Will an OTH discharge affect civilian life?

If you received an OTH discharge, you cannot get education benefits under the G.I. Bill, nor can you receive a military pension or apply for a VA home loan. … You also lose your protections against military-related discriminations associated with civilian employment.

Regarding this, are you considered a veteran with a OTH discharge?

But for certain benefit programs, current law defines a veteran as anyone (1) with an OTH discharge and a qualifying condition (i.e., a diagnosis of PTSD or traumatic brain injury or a disclosed military sexual trauma) or (2) discharged or released under conditions other than dishonorable from active service in the …

Subsequently, can a OTH discharge be upgraded? Upgrading your OTH Discharge is possible if you can show the Discharge Review Board or Board for the Correction of Military Records that your OTH Discharge was either improper or unjust.

Can you get a security clearance with an other than honorable discharge?

Receipt of an OTH may impact on an ability to obtain a clearance, but receiving an OTH does not preclude getting a clearance in the same manner as does receipt of a Dishonorable Discharge/Dismissal.

Can you rejoin the military with a other than honorable discharge?

The most severe type of military administrative discharge is other-than-honorable conditions. … In most cases, veterans who receive an other-than-honorable discharge cannot re-enlist in the Armed Forces or reserves, except under very rare circumstances.

Is other than honorable discharge considered dishonorable?

Veterans with Other Than Honorable discharges who are deemed “Dishonorable for VA Purposes” because of a regulatory bar may still qualify for health care for a service-connected condition or injury only. If the veteran is barred due to a statutory condition, this limited health care is not available.
